A buddy of mine and his fiancé are riding in the MS150 bike ride again. It is a 150 mile ride, the proceeds of which go toward researching a cure for MS.

Interesting fact: Utah has one of the highest incidence rates of MS in the nation, with an estimated 1 in 500 affected by MS, as compared to 1 in 10,000 in
Texas. This is attributable to a combination of environmental and genetic factors. MS is more common among people of northern European ancestry (common in Utah) and occurs with much greater frequency in higher latitudes away from the equator. This means that, statistically speaking, each of us are going to know and interact on a familiar basis with at least one person who has MS.
